Salmon with Feta Dill Sauce Ingredients: 4 salmon fillets (3 to 4 ounces each) 1 tablespoon lemon juice Old Bay seasoning, to taste 2 tablespoons butter 1 1/4 cups heavy cream 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ard 4 oz crumbled feta cheese 3 tablespoons chopped fresh dill (reserve some for garnish) Directions: Season the salmon fillets with lemon juice and a sprinkle of Old Bay seasoning. Cook the salmon in the air fryer at 400°F for 8 to 10 minutes, or bake in the oven on a baking sheet at 400°F for 8 to 10 minutes until flaky and fully cooked. In a skillet over high heat, melt the butter and add the heavy cream, Dijon mustard, and a bit of Old Bay seasoning. When the mixture begins to bubble, reduce the heat to medium-low and simmer for 3 minutes, stirring occasionally. Add the crumbled feta cheese and most of the fresh dill, reserving some dill for garnish. Continue to cook the sauce for an additional 2-3 minutes, stirring until it reaches your desired thickness. Serve the sauce over the cooked salmon fillets, garnishing with the reserved fresh dill. Prep Time: 5 minutes | Cooking Time: 15 minutes | Total Time: 20 minutes Kcal: 350 kcal per serving | Servings: 4 servings This Salmon with Feta Dill Sauce combines tender, flaky salmon with a creamy, herbaceous sauce that adds a burst of fresh flavor to every bite. The subtle tanginess of the feta cheese pairs perfectly with the bright, aromatic dill and smooth cream, creating a sauce that complements the richness of the salmon beautifully. Ideal for a quick and elegant meal, this dish is simple yet packed with flavor. It can be prepared in under 20 minutes, making it perfect for busy weeknights or even a dinner party where you want to impress. Serve it with a side of steamed vegetables or roasted potatoes for a complete meal thats sure to become a new favorite.

A tasty venison roast cooked in an Instant Pot and served with a rich red wine balsamic herb sauce. This dish is great for a hearty meal because the meat is soft and full of flavor thanks to the pressure cooking method.
Ingredients: 3 lbs venison roast. 1 cup red wine. 1/2 cup balsamic vinegar. 1 cup beef or venison broth. 2 tablespoons olive oil. 4 cloves garlic, minced. 1 tablespoon dried rosemary. 1 tablespoon dried thyme. Salt and pepper to taste. 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our for optional thickening.
Instructions: Add salt, pepper, rosemary, and thyme to the venison roast to make it taste better. Put the Instant Pot on "Saute" and heat the olive oil. The venison roast should be seared on all sides until it turns brown. Add the minced garlic and cook for one to two minutes, until the garlic smells good. Vinegar, broth, and red wine should all be added. To clear the pot, stir. Set the Instant Pot to "Manual" or "Pressure Cook" mode and close the lid. Cook on high pressure for 60 minutes. After the food is done cooking, let the pressure drop naturally for 15 minutes. Then, manually release any pressure that is still there. If you want the sauce to be thicker, you can make a slurry by mixing 2 tablespoons of flour with a little water. Add to the sauce and cook until it gets thicker. Cut up the roast deer and serve it with the red wine, balsamic, and herb sauce. Add fresh herbs on top and enjoy!
Prep Time: 15 minutes
Cook Time: 75 minutes

Enjoy the elegance of this creamy herb chicken dish. Tender chicken breasts are covered in a rich sauce that has fresh thyme and rosemary in it. The flavors go well together and will make any meal better.
Ingredients: 4 chicken breasts. 1 tablespoon olive oil. 2 cloves garlic, minced. 1 cup chicken broth. 1 cup heavy cream. 1 tablespoon fresh thyme, chopped. 1 tablespoon fresh rosemary, chopped. Salt and pepper to taste.
Instructions: In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at. Season chicken breasts with salt and pepper, then add them to the skillet. Cook chicken until golden brown on both sides, about 5-7 minutes per side. Remove chicken from skillet and set aside. In the same skillet, add minced garlic and saut until fragrant, about 1 minute. Pour in chicken broth, scraping up any browned bits from the bottom of the skillet. Stir in heavy cream, thyme, and rosemary. Return chicken to the skillet and simmer until the sauce thickens and chicken is cooked through, about 10 minutes. Serve chicken topped with creamy herb sauce. Enjoy!
Prep Time: 10 minutes
Cook Time: 25 minutes
